#ifdef HAVE_CONFIG_H
# include <config.h>
#endif

#include <dwarf.h>
#include "libdwP.h"


static Dwarf_Die *
get_type (Dwarf_Die *die, Dwarf_Attribute *attr_mem, Dwarf_Die *type_mem)
{
  Dwarf_Die *type = INTUSE(dwarf_formref_die)
    (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(die, DW_AT_type, attr_mem), type_mem);

  if (INTUSE(dwarf_peel_type) (type, type) != 0)
    return NULL;

  return type;
}

static int aggregate_size (Dwarf_Die *die, Dwarf_Word *size,
			   Dwarf_Die *type_mem, int depth);

static int
array_size (Dwarf_Die *die, Dwarf_Word *size,
	    Dwarf_Attribute *attr_mem, int depth)
{
  Dwarf_Word eltsize;
  Dwarf_Die type_mem, aggregate_type_mem;
  if (aggregate_size (get_type (die, attr_mem, &type_mem), &eltsize,
		      &aggregate_type_mem, depth) != 0)
      return -1;

  /* An array can have DW_TAG_subrange_type or DW_TAG_enumeration_type
     children instead that give the size of each dimension.  */

  Dwarf_Die child;
  if (INTUSE(dwarf_child) (die, &child) != 0)
    return -1;

  bool any = false;
  Dwarf_Word count_total = 1;
  do
    {
      Dwarf_Word count;
      switch (INTUSE(dwarf_tag) (&child))
	{
	case DW_TAG_subrange_type:
	  /* This has either DW_AT_count or DW_AT_upper_bound.  */
	  if (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(&child, DW_AT_count,
					    attr_mem) != NULL)
	    {
	      if (INTUSE(dwarf_formudata) (attr_mem, &count) != 0)
		return -1;
	    }
	  else
	    {
	      Dwarf_Sword upper;
	      Dwarf_Sword lower;
	      if (INTUSE(dwarf_formsdata) (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ate)
					   (&child, DW_AT_upper_bound,
					    attr_mem), &upper) != 0)
		return -1;

	      /* Having DW_AT_lower_bound is optional.  */
	      if (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(&child, DW_AT_lower_bound,
						attr_mem) != NULL)
		{
		  if (INTUSE(dwarf_formsdata) (attr_mem, &lower) != 0)
		    return -1;
		}
	      else
		{
		  Dwarf_Die cu = CUDIE (die->cu);
		  int lang = INTUSE(dwarf_srclang) (&cu);
		  if (lang == -1
		      || INTUSE(dwarf_default_lower_bound) (lang, &lower) != 0)
		    return -1;
		}
	      if (unlikely (lower > upper))
		return -1;
	      count = upper - lower + 1;
	    }
	  break;

	case DW_TAG_enumeration_type:
	  /* We have to find the DW_TAG_enumerator child with the
	     highest value to know the array's element count.  */
	  count = 0;
	  Dwarf_Die enum_child;
	  int has_children = INTUSE(dwarf_child) (die, &enum_child);
	  if (has_children < 0)
	    return -1;
	  if (has_children > 0)
	    do
	      if (INTUSE(dwarf_tag) (&enum_child) == DW_TAG_enumerator)
		{
		  Dwarf_Word value;
		  if (INTUSE(dwarf_formudata) (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ate)
					       (&enum_child, DW_AT_const_value,
						attr_mem), &value) != 0)
		    return -1;
		  if (value >= count)
		    count = value + 1;
		}
	    while (INTUSE(dwarf_siblingof) (&enum_child, &enum_child) > 0);
	  break;

	default:
	  continue;
	}

      count_total *= count;

      any = true;
    }
  while (INTUSE(dwarf_siblingof) (&child, &child) == 0);

  if (!any)
    return -1;

  /* This is a subrange_type or enumeration_type and we've set COUNT.
     Now determine the stride for this array.  */
  Dwarf_Word stride = eltsize;
  if (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(die, DW_AT_byte_stride,
                                    attr_mem) != NULL)
    {
      if (INTUSE(dwarf_formudata) (attr_mem, &stride) != 0)
        return -1;
    }
  else if (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(die, DW_AT_bit_stride,
                                         attr_mem) != NULL)
    {
      if (INTUSE(dwarf_formudata) (attr_mem, &stride) != 0)
        return -1;
      if (stride % 8) 	/* XXX maybe compute in bits? */
        return -1;
      stride /= 8;
    }

  *size = count_total * stride;
  return 0;
}

static int
aggregate_size (Dwarf_Die *die, Dwarf_Word *size,
		Dwarf_Die *type_mem, int depth)
{
  Dwarf_Attribute attr_mem;

/* Arrays of arrays of subrange types of arrays... Don't recurse too deep.  */
#define MAX_DEPTH 256
  if (die == NULL || depth++ >= MAX_DEPTH)
    return -1;

  if (INTUSE(dwarf_attr_integrate) (die, DW_AT_byte_size, &attr_mem) != NULL)
    return INTUSE(dwarf_formudata) (&attr_mem, size);

  switch (INTUSE(dwarf_tag) (die))
    {
    case DW_TAG_subrange_type:
      {
	Dwarf_Die aggregate_type_mem;
	return aggregate_size (get_type (die, &attr_mem, type_mem),
			       size, &aggregate_type_mem, depth);
      }

    case DW_TAG_array_type:
      return array_size (die, size, &attr_mem, depth);

    /* Assume references and pointers have pointer size if not given an
       explicit DW_AT_byte_size.  */
    case DW_TAG_pointer_type:
    case DW_TAG_reference_type:
    case DW_TAG_rvalue_reference_type:
      *size = die->cu->address_size;
      return 0;
    }

  /* Most types must give their size directly.  */
  return -1;
}

int
dwarf_aggregate_size (Dwarf_Die *die, Dwarf_Word *size)
{
  Dwarf_Die die_mem, type_mem;

  if (INTUSE (dwarf_peel_type) (die, &die_mem) != 0)
    return -1;

  return aggregate_size (&die_mem, size, &type_mem, 0);
}
INTDEF (dwarf_aggregate_size)
OLD_VERSION (dwarf_aggregate_size, ELFUTILS_0.144)
NEW_VERSION (dwarf_aggregate_size, ELFUTILS_0.161)
